Carterton Community College is a mixed secondary school located in Carterton in the English county of Oxfordshire.[2]

It is a community school administered by Oxfordshire County Council. The school offers GCSEs, BTECs and OCR Nationals as programmes of study for pupils.[3]

In 2007, former headteacher Alan Klee was found guilty of bullying staff and misconduct while at Carterton Community College. Mr Klee resigned from Carterton Community College in 2003.[4]

The school won the School Library Association Library Design Award in 2013.[5]
